194 | /* Create a fundamental C type using default reasonable for the current | |
195 | target machine. | |
196 | ||
197 | Some object/debugging file formats (DWARF version 1, COFF, etc) do not | |
198 | define fundamental types such as "int" or "double". Others (stabs or | |
199 | DWARF version 2, etc) do define fundamental types. For the formats which | |
200 | don't provide fundamental types, gdb can create such types using this | |
201 | function. | |
202 | ||
203 | FIXME: Some compilers distinguish explicitly signed integral types | |
204 | (signed short, signed int, signed long) from "regular" integral types | |
205 | (short, int, long) in the debugging information. There is some dis- | |
206 | agreement as to how useful this feature is. In particular, gcc does | |
207 | not support this. Also, only some debugging formats allow the | |
208 | distinction to be passed on to a debugger. For now, we always just | |
209 | use "short", "int", or "long" as the type name, for both the implicit | |
210 | and explicitly signed types. This also makes life easier for the | |
211 | gdb test suite since we don't have to account for the differences | |
212 | in output depending upon what the compiler and debugging format | |
213 | support. We will probably have to re-examine the issue when gdb | |
214 | starts taking it's fundamental type information directly from the | |
215 | debugging information supplied by the compiler. fnf@cygnus.com */ | |
